If you're searching for the perfect 6-string electric guitar with a full range of accessories for a student, beginner, intermediate, or advanced guitar player, the Davison full-size electric guitar is an outstanding choice. Sold as a complete kit with all of the accessories, this guitar package offers excellent quality at a very attractive price. This guitar from Davison is a 39" solid body electric guitar. It features a flawless glossy finish, a maple neck with a finely finished fretboard, nickel frets, an adjustable chrome bridge, and six steel strings. It has a humbucker pickup for that rock sound, as well as two controls - one for tone, one for volume. Because it comes as a fully-equipped package, this guitar includes a 10 watt electric guitar amp with built-in overdrive and distortion, perfect for practice, playing at home, or warmups. Everything you need is included in this beginner guitar package, a padded gig bag with backpack straps, shoulder strap, cable, and three picks in assorted colors. At first I could tell no difference between this Guitar and my Friend's $1,500 Les Paul (because I was/am SOOOO new to the instrument... any instrument actually) but have quickly started to see the differences. This Guitar seems to sound sloppy and loose and feels that way after getting a feel for the guitar in general(even though it DOES keep tuned very well). Nicer Guitars seem to feel more fine-tuned and responsive and hold notes longer. Playing this Guitar and a high-end one side by side (by someone who knows what they are doing) provides very different sound to someone who knows what to listen for.
Simply put, this guitar is more than worth the Money... but once you get addicted to Guitar, which I have in the two weeks I've had it (I've played for probably 30-35 hours already)... I am already trying to rationalize reasons to buy a much nice (and more expensive) Guitar that plays "smoother".
I give this product 5 stars because of the price. If its wasn't so Cheap, I'd never have gotten into Guitar... now I am addicted and see the benifits of a more expensive Guitar, and appreciation for the instrument.
- Has only one pickup and that's near the bridge. Don't expect rich, deep tone. This guitar is obviously designed to appeal to the younger generation looking for metal / distortion guitar playing... thus the location of the pickup.
+ But it's a rather nice humbucker and pulls the best sound possible out of this guitar, considering its location.
+ The body is pristine, gorgeously finished. The wood (at least on the one I received) was well-assembled with joint marks just barely visible and blended in with the transparent / grin finish. It's an attractive guitar.
+ A swirl-maple 1/16" veneer on the surface of the neck provides an attractive and durable surface
+ The neck is straight and sturdy. I did not have to adjust the guitar or action at all... rare with off-the-shelf guitars.
+ The amplifier with this-- although predictably "tinny" due to the small speaker size-- is surprisingly robust. The basic tone is clear and clean, even at higher volume. Hit the "overdrive" button and you can get all the dirt and grit you want. Overall, it is a much better amp than a similarly-configured competitors guitar set (which I also bought. In short... this guitar set is better).
+ I like that the bottom of the neck (where it joins the body) is rounded and smoothed rather than cut off straight as we see with some guitars in this price range.
+ Comes with everything you need-- guitar cord, strap, picks, tuner and gig bag.
In summary-- this is a nicer guitar set than I thought it would be when I first purchased it. You get the entire set for about the price of a Fender Squier and the nicer tone and power of a humbucker pickup (although of course, not the tonal versatility of a 3-pickup Squier). I consider this guitar set to be well worth the purchase price and a good choice for a beginning guitar player.
